When Is Shearing Machine Cylinder Seal Replacement Needed?

Машина для стрижки овец Cylinder Seal Replacement is one of the most important maintenance tasks I consider when a hydraulic shearing machine begins to show performance issues. Cylinder seals play a critical role in maintaining hydraulic pressure, preventing oil leakage, and ensuring stable blade movement. When seals become worn, hardened, or damaged, the machine may experience slow operation, reduced cutting force, hydraulic leakage, or inaccurate cutting performance. How Hydraulic Cylinder Seals Work

Hydraulic cylinder seals are designed to maintain oil pressure inside the cylinder while preventing hydraulic fluid from leaking. During shearing operations, the cylinder relies on stable pressure to move the upper blade smoothly and generate sufficient cutting force.

Why Cylinder Seal Condition Affects Cutting Performance

When seals operate normally, the hydraulic system can maintain consistent pressure and movement. However, damaged seals may allow internal leakage, reducing cylinder efficiency and affecting cutting accuracy, especially during heavy-duty operations.

Common Signs That Shearing Machine Cylinder Seal Replacement Is Needed

Hydraulic Oil Leakage Around the Cylinder

One of the most visible signs of seal failure is hydraulic oil leakage around the cylinder rod or cylinder body. External leakage indicates that the seal can no longer effectively contain hydraulic fluid.

If oil continues leaking after cleaning and tightening connections, I recommend inspecting the cylinder seals immediately. Delaying replacement may cause further contamination and damage to other hydraulic components.

Reduced Cutting Force or Slow Blade Movement

A worn cylinder seal can cause internal oil bypass, preventing the hydraulic cylinder from building enough pressure. As a result, the shearing machine may struggle with thicker materials or operate slower than normal.

If the machine requires longer cycle times or cannot achieve its rated cutting capacity, checking the cylinder seals should be part of the troubleshooting process.

Uneven Blade Movement During Operation

Hydraulic cylinders with damaged seals may not move smoothly. Operators may notice inconsistent blade movement, vibration, or uneven cutting pressure across the material.

In this situation, Shearing Machine Cylinder Seal Replacement can restore hydraulic stability and improve cutting consistency.

Excessive Hydraulic Oil Consumption

If hydraulic oil levels drop frequently without visible external leaks, internal leakage may be occurring inside the cylinder. Damaged seals allow oil to pass between cylinder chambers, reducing system efficiency.

Regular monitoring of hydraulic oil consumption helps identify seal problems before they cause major downtime.

How to Check Cylinder Seals Before Replacement

Step 1: Inspect for External Leakage

Before replacing seals, I always recommend checking the cylinder surface, rod area, and hydraulic connections. Clean the cylinder and observe whether new oil appears during operation.

Step 2: Test Hydraulic Pressure Stability

Use pressure monitoring equipment to verify whether the hydraulic system maintains the required pressure. Unstable pressure may indicate internal seal failure.

Step 3: Check Cylinder Movement Performance

Observe whether the cylinder extends and retracts smoothly. Slow movement, sudden stops, or uneven motion are common indicators of seal wear.

Step 4: Inspect Seal Condition During Maintenance

When the cylinder is disassembled, check the seal surface for cracks, deformation, hardening, or excessive wear. These conditions confirm that replacement is required.

Best Practices for Shearing Machine Cylinder Seal Replacement

Choose High-Quality Replacement Seals

Using the correct seal material and specification is essential. Hydraulic cylinders operate under high pressure, so low-quality seals may fail quickly and increase maintenance frequency.

Clean the Cylinder Before Installation

Before installing new seals, thoroughly clean the cylinder components. Dust, metal particles, or hydraulic contamination can damage new seals and shorten service life.

Maintain Proper Hydraulic Oil Quality

Clean hydraulic oil reduces wear on seals and other hydraulic components. Regular oil inspection and filtration help prevent premature seal failure.

Perform Regular Hydraulic System Inspections

Preventive maintenance is more effective than waiting for failures. Regularly checking oil levels, pressure performance, and leakage conditions helps identify problems early.

ЧАСТО ЗАДАВАЕМЫЕ ВОПРОСЫ

How often should shearing machine cylinder seals be replaced?

Replacement frequency depends on machine usage, operating pressure, hydraulic oil condition, and working environment. Regular inspection is more reliable than replacing seals based only on time.

Can I continue operating a shearing machine with a leaking cylinder seal?

It is not recommended. A leaking seal can reduce hydraulic performance and may cause additional damage to cylinders, pumps, and valves.

What causes cylinder seals to wear out quickly?

Common causes include contaminated hydraulic oil, excessive pressure, improper installation, high operating temperatures, and lack of maintenance.

Will replacing cylinder seals improve cutting accuracy?

Yes. Properly functioning seals help maintain stable hydraulic pressure, improving blade movement accuracy and cutting consistency.
